🔑 Enhanced Key Takeaways
- •Japan's labor shortage, driven by an aging demographic, is forcing a shift in government policy to incentivize AI integration despite corporate hesitation.
- •The 'hanko' (personal seal) culture and reliance on physical paperwork remain significant legacy infrastructure barriers that complicate the digitization required for AI implementation.
- •Japanese firms often prioritize 'monozukuri' (the art of making things) over software-centric innovation, leading to a mismatch between AI capabilities and traditional manufacturing workflows.
- •Data privacy concerns and strict interpretation of the Act on the Protection of Personal Information (APPI) have led many Japanese enterprises to adopt private, on-premise LLMs rather than public cloud solutions.
- •The Japanese government has launched the 'AI Strategy 2025' and subsequent initiatives to provide subsidies and regulatory sandboxes specifically designed to lower the barrier to entry for SMEs.
🛠️ Technical Deep Dive
- Shift toward Small Language Models (SLMs) and domain-specific models tailored for the Japanese language, which often perform better on local business nuances than generalized global models.
- Increased adoption of Retrieval-Augmented Generation (RAG) architectures to allow companies to query internal, proprietary databases without exposing sensitive data to public training sets.
- Implementation of 'AI-on-Edge' solutions in manufacturing sectors to reduce latency and maintain data sovereignty within factory environments.
- Development of Japanese-specific LLM benchmarks (such as JGLUE) to evaluate model performance on domestic linguistic and cultural tasks.
